Output 34af45ff8a2dfba56ce751da49cf7f2e80292652be197f31927f95bd659f7fdc:17

value
1660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0988a1fd8f670aa295dcd0c5126ae8326dd660e OP_EQUAL
address
3LhyD5V2gYhDDFDYiN7XhJvXKdCZbn6wfJ
transaction
34af45ff8a2dfba56ce751da49cf7f2e80292652be197f31927f95bd659f7fdc
confirmations
341033
spent
true